#f0a382 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f0a382 is composed of 94.1% red, 63.9%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 32.1% magenta, 45.8%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 18 degrees, a saturation of 78.6% and a lightness of 72.5%. #f0a382 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e14705. Closest websafe color is: #ff9999.

● #f0a382 color description : Soft orange.
#f0a382 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f0a382 has RGB values of R:240, G:163, B:130 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.32, Y:0.46,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15770498.

Shades and Tints of #f0a382
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0602 is the darkest color, while #fffd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#f0a382
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bab9b8 is the less saturated color, while #fb9f77 is the most saturated one.
